From 65b23c4ff7ba3e13df7b8d9108f99fa22982bf28 Mon Sep 17 00:00:00 2001 From: Cassandra Heart Date: Fri, 14 Mar 2025 12:05:30 -0500 Subject: [PATCH] minor tweaks --- node/rpc/hypergraph_sync_rpc_server.go | 38 -------------------------- 1 file changed, 38 deletions(-) diff --git a/node/rpc/hypergraph_sync_rpc_server.go b/node/rpc/hypergraph_sync_rpc_server.go index b9b9cee..f079e74 100644 --- a/node/rpc/hypergraph_sync_rpc_server.go +++ b/node/rpc/hypergraph_sync_rpc_server.go @@ -310,7 +310,6 @@ type streamManager struct { stream HyperStream hypergraphStore store.HypergraphStore localTree *crypto.VectorCommitmentTree - leavesSent int lastSent time.Time } @@ -378,10 +377,6 @@ func (s *streamManager) sendLeafData( if child == nil { continue } - s.leavesSent++ - if s.leavesSent > 100000 { - return nil - } if err := send(child); err != nil { return err @@ -668,10 +663,6 @@ func (s *streamManager) walk( incomingResponses <-chan *protobufs.HypergraphComparisonResponse, metadataOnly bool, ) error { - if s.leavesSent > 100000 { - return nil - } - select { case <-s.ctx.Done(): return s.ctx.Err() @@ -1068,7 +1059,6 @@ func syncTreeBidirectionallyServer( }() lastReceived := time.Now() - leavesReceived := 0 outer: for { @@ -1077,10 +1067,6 @@ outer: if !ok { break outer } - leavesReceived++ - if leavesReceived > 100000 { - break outer - } logger.Info( "received leaf data", @@ -1089,15 +1075,6 @@ outer: theirs := hypergraph.AtomFromBytes(remoteUpdate.Value) - ours, _ := idSet.GetTree().Get(remoteUpdate.Key) - if ours != nil { - ourCommit := hypergraph.AtomFromBytes(ours).Commit() - theirCommit := theirs.Commit() - if bytes.Compare(ourCommit, theirCommit) < 0 { - continue - } - } - if len(remoteUpdate.UnderlyingData) != 0 { txn, err := localHypergraphStore.NewTransaction(false) if err != nil { @@ -1346,7 +1323,6 @@ func SyncTreeBidirectionally( }() lastReceived := time.Now() - leavesReceived := 0 outer: for { @@ -1356,11 +1332,6 @@ outer: break outer } - leavesReceived++ - if leavesReceived > 100000 { - break outer - } - logger.Info( "received leaf data", zap.String("key", hex.EncodeToString(remoteUpdate.Key)), @@ -1368,15 +1339,6 @@ outer: theirs := hypergraph.AtomFromBytes(remoteUpdate.Value) - ours, _ := set.GetTree().Get(remoteUpdate.Key) - if ours != nil { - ourCommit := hypergraph.AtomFromBytes(ours).Commit() - theirCommit := theirs.Commit() - if bytes.Compare(ourCommit, theirCommit) < 0 { - continue - } - } - if len(remoteUpdate.UnderlyingData) != 0 { txn, err := hypergraphStore.NewTransaction(false) if err != nil {